Post subject:  Need alignment specs for Daystar KJ09123

I recently installed a KJ09123 spacer lift on my 2003 Jeep Liberty Sport about 10 days ago. The vehicle is currently sitting in a Midas service bay because the technician doesn't know how to align it because of the lift kit. :evil:

The Daystar dealer who sold me the parts (All J Products) said only the toe settings need to be adjusted. The guy at Midas needs to know how much, since factory spec no longer applies. I've e-mailed Daystar's tech support site and will call them in a few minutes. They're two or three hours behind me, so I don't know if anyone can even answer the phones yet.

Can't I just tell Midas to set the toe to factory spec?

Author:  JJsTJ [ Wed Nov 29, 2006 11:28 am ]
Post subject: 

The shops I have used just try to get it as close as possible to factory. So far there has not been a problem and that is between a couple alignments on two different KJ's.
